What is GradeLab?
GradeLab is an assessment platform built for schools, universities, coaching centers, and government exam bodies that need to grade handwritten and digital exams faster without giving up teacher control. Upload scanned answer sheets or run online tests, and the system applies your rubrics to score essays, math, diagrams, and mixed-format papers while flagging anything that needs a human review.
What sets it apart is the focus on real exam workflows: OCR trained on student handwriting across 30+ languages, on-screen marking for distributed examiners, question generation from PDFs, LaTeX exam paper formatting, and REST APIs for LMS and EdTech integrations. Institutions can deploy on-premise so exam data stays inside their network.
GradeLab targets K-12 schools, higher-ed departments, test-prep centers, corporate training teams, and public-sector assessment programs that process large paper volumes and want consistent grading with analytics parents and administrators can actually read.

What is Axiom AI?
Axiom AI is browser automation software you build through a Chrome extension, code APIs, or plain-language prompts to Claude. You connect prebuilt steps in a visual builder to scrape pages, fill forms, monitor sites, or run multi-step workflows without writing scripts from scratch.
Most RPA tools force you to pick either a no-code recorder or a developer SDK. Axiom AI ships both paths plus a Claude Code skill that generates automations from descriptions, then runs them on hosted cloud browsers or locally on your desktop with unlimited concurrency.
It fits ops teams, growth marketers, and developers who need repeatable web tasks at scale. Cloud plans cap single runs at 1 to 12 hours depending on tier, while the desktop runner supports minute-level scheduling with no concurrency limit on your own machine.
